arXiv:2601.12178v2 Announce Type: replace Abstract: We propose a federated learning framework for the calibration of parametric insurance indices under heterogeneous renewable energy production losses. Producers locally model their losses using Tweedie generalized linear models and private data, while a common index is learned through federated optimization without sharing raw observations. The approach accommodates heterogeneity in variance and link functions and directly minimizes a global deviance objective in a distributed setting. We establish theoretical guarantees under sub-exponential covariate distributions, showing that the Lipschitz constants of the local Tweedie objectives scale as $\frac{1}{\phi_i}$, where $\phi_i$ is the dispersion parameter of producer $i$. This heterogeneity in smoothness causes naive federated averaging to be biased toward producers with stable microclimates --- precisely those least in need of basis-risk protection --- and motivates the use of corrected aggregation schemes. We implement and compare FedAvg, FedProx and FedOpt, and benchmark them against an existing approximation-based aggregation method. A progressive pool expansion experiment involving up to 121 solar farms in Germany reveals that the approximation-based method becomes entirely non-computable beyond the pool of 50 farms, while federated learning remains valid and actively improves as the pool grows.
